Wrigleyville in Chicago, IL offers an energetic North Side lifestyle centered around Wrigley Field, Clark Street, dining, nightlife, transit access, and classic Chicago residential streets. Wrigleyville real estate includes condominiums, vintage walk-ups, apartment buildings, townhomes, courtyard residences, and select single-family homes in a highly walkable setting. Homes for sale in Wrigleyville appeal to buyers seeking city convenience, entertainment, restaurants, CTA Red Line access, and proximity to Lakeview, Boystown, Southport Corridor, and the lakefront. From residences near Addison and Clark to quieter blocks just beyond the ballpark activity, Wrigleyville offers a recognizable mix of urban excitement, neighborhood character, and everyday access.
Living in Wrigleyville means enjoying one of Chicago’s most recognizable neighborhoods, where sports culture, local restaurants, bars, music venues, shops, and residential convenience come together. Residents can visit Wrigley Field, explore Clark Street, enjoy nearby dining and entertainment, connect to CTA trains and buses, and reach surrounding North Side destinations with ease. The Wrigleyville housing market features a range of options, including updated condos, vintage apartments, rental buildings, townhomes, and classic Chicago homes. With its strong walkability, active commercial corridors, transit connections, and close proximity to Lakeview, Lincoln Park, Uptown, and Lake Michigan, Wrigleyville remains a standout choice for city living.
